Uno degli aspetti fondamentali che ogni organizzazione deve avere, e quindi ognuno di noi, è eseguire backup regolari del sistema e dei file più sensibili che abbiamo, poiché questo ci dà la possibilità di mantenere tutte le informazioni disponibili, sicure e aggiornate in caso di guasto del sistema, perdita di informazioni, imitazioni, danni strutturali, tra le altre situazioni.
Sappiamo che quando parliamo di backup non ci occupiamo solo di copiare file o record poiché dietro a tutto questo ci sono vari parametri che dobbiamo tenere in considerazione come:
- Tipi di backup (incrementale, differenziale, ecc.)
- Tipo di crittografia supportato
- Possibilità di eseguire il backup dell'intera immagine del sistema
- Supporto remoto, tra gli altri
Quando all'interno dell'infrastruttura a livello di sistema gestiamo computer con sistemi operativi Linux, dobbiamo scegliere il i migliori strumenti per questo processo e quindi oggi Solvetic analizzerà quali sono gli strumenti migliori sia a livello di terminale che di interfaccia grafica per questo importante compito come personale IT.
Analisi dettagliata
La selezione di Strumenti di backup per Linux è molto ampia, ma dobbiamo sapere quali di questi sono i migliori per poter selezionare quello che ci interessa di più. Allora sarai in grado di sapere dos dei migliori strumenti per eseguire gratuitamente copie di backup in Linux. I seguenti tutorial includono un'analisi approfondita del programma e una spiegazione su come installarlo e configurarlo.
poppinsÈ un programma gratuito. Questo strumento a riga di comando è stato sviluppato in PHP, che ci darà la possibilità di generare il backup delle informazioni sensibili che gestiamo, fornendoci un alto livello di sicurezza.
poppins
istantaneaLo strumento Rsnapshot è un'utilità basata su Rsync. Supporta vari sistemi operativi come: Arch Linux, Debian, Fedora, Gentoo Linux, Ubuntu, FreeBSD, NetBSD e OpenBSD
istantanea
Obnam
Con Obnam abbiamo la possibilità di scattare istantanee del sistema e ci dà la possibilità di archiviare copie di backup su hard disk o in rete utilizzando il protocollo SSH. Le caratteristiche più importanti quando si utilizza Obnam sono:
- Genera backup rimuovendo i file duplicati
- Backup istantanee
- Sistema di crittografia del backup utilizzando GnuPG.
- Open source
Per installare l'applicazione dobbiamo definire la distro che stiamo eseguendo per la corretta installazione, in questo caso utilizziamo Ubuntu 16 e per installare Obnam utilizzeremo il seguente comando per aggiungere un particolare repository:
sudo apt-add-repository ppa: chris-bigballofwax / obnam-ppaUna volta installato utilizzeremo il seguente comando per la rispettiva installazione:
sudo apt-get install obnamLa sintassi per l'utilizzo di Obnam (terminale Via) è la seguente:
obnam backup -r Directory_destinazione DirectorylocaleAd esempio, per fare un backup della cartella Documenti e posizionare il backup sul desktop utilizzeremo la seguente riga:
obnam backup -r / home / Desktop ~ / Documenti
Obnam
Rsync
Con Rsync abbiamo un altro ottimo strumento di backup a portata di mano utilizzando il terminale. Con Rsync abbiamo i seguenti vantaggi:
- Possibilità di aggiornare l'intero albero di directory e il file system
- Non richiede privilegi di amministratore per l'uso
- Possiamo usare SSH o RSH come protocolli di trasporto
- Puoi mantenere i privilegi sui file
- Consumo di risorse ridotto
- Riduzione della latenza per più file
Rsync di default è già installato sul sistema, possiamo vedere la sua versione usando il comando rsync -versione. La sintassi per l'utilizzo di Rsync è molto semplice:
Rsync -a Sorgente/DestinazioneParametro -a fa riferimento che il contenuto originale deve essere preso esclusivamente, preservando tutti i suoi valori. In questo esempio useremo la seguente sintassi
rsync -a Documenti/DesktopPossiamo vedere che il contenuto della cartella Documenti (in questo caso un file eseguibile) viene copiato sul desktop.
Rsync
Grsync
Con questo strumento abbiamo la possibilità di mantenere i valori dei file all'interno della copia di backup. I vantaggi che ci offre sono i seguenti:
- Interfaccia grafica facile da usare
- Possibilità di utilizzare un test di valutazione per verificare i risultati finali
- Possibilità di sincronizzare i file tra due siti diversi
- Supporta più sistemi operativi come Windows, Mac e Linux
- Può salvare più file con nomi personalizzati
- Puoi importare ed esportare sessioni con i file
- Il processo di backup può essere sospeso senza problemi in qualsiasi momento
- Configurazione facile
- Supporta il framework
- Le sessioni possono essere create durante il processo di backup
Grsync
Borg torna indietro
Borg Backup è uno strumento che ci dà la possibilità di creare copie di backup in modo semplice, consentendone la crittografia e la compressione. Con questo strumento avremo la possibilità di quanto segue:
Conservazione efficiente dello spazio
- Crittografia dei dati tramite crittografia AES a 256 bit
- Alta velocità di backup
- I backup possono essere montati come file system
- Supporta piattaforme Linux, Mac OS X, FreeBSD, OpenBSD, ecc.
- Possibilità di archiviare in remoto tramite SSH
Per l'installazione di Borg Backup (Si usa attraverso il terminale) useremo il seguente comando:
sudo apt-get install borgbackup borgbackup-docDobbiamo creare un repository in cui verranno archiviate le copie di backup, utilizzeremo il seguente comando:
borg init / Percorso repositoryPer creare il file di backup utilizzeremo la seguente sintassi:
borg create -v -stats / Percorso repository :: Nome file ~ / Documenti
Borg torna indietro
kup
KUP è uno strumento grafico che sarà di grande aiuto nelle nostre attività di backup. Le eccezionali caratteristiche di KUP sono le seguenti:
- Possiamo creare backup incrementali o differenziali
- Abbiamo la possibilità di programmare backup in base alle necessità (giornaliero, settimanale, mensile)
- Interfaccia grafica facile da usare
- Supporta Rsync
- Ha moduli di configurazione
- Ha uno strumento di ricerca per individuare facilmente i file
kup
Tornare in tempo
Insieme a Tornare in tempo abbiamo a portata di mano uno strumento gratuito che ci fornirà ottime alternative in termini di backup. Le caratteristiche più importanti di Back In Time sono:
- Possibilità di pianificare i backup per minuti, ore, giorni o settimane
- Interfaccia semplice da usare
- Possiamo configurare dove archiviare le istantanee
- Possibilità di eseguire il backup dell'intero sistema operativo
- Lo strumento sostituisce automaticamente le vecchie istantanee con quelle nuove
tornare in tempo
DarGUI
DarGUI è uno strumento grafico semplice ma potente che ci darà la possibilità di effettuare vari tipi di backup dei nostri file o del nostro sistema. Tra le principali caratteristiche che predominano in DarGUI abbiamo:
- Può creare file differenziali
- Puoi aggiungere file al gestore DAR dello strumento
- Ha la capacità di estrarre o ripristinare uno o tutti i file dal backup
- È possibile vedere il contenuto dei file DAR
- È possibile confrontare i file
- DarGUI può convalidare l'integrità dei file nel backup
- È possibile modificare il tipo di file
- Possiamo eseguire backup programmati
DarGUI
FWBackup
FWbackup è un altro degli strumenti che ci danno la possibilità di gestire in modo semplice e pratico le copie di backup di file e cartelle in Linux. Tra le grandi caratteristiche che rendono FWbackups un ottimo strumento abbiamo:
- Possibilità di eseguire il backup dell'intero sistema operativo
- Interfaccia semplice
- Configurazione semplice e flessibile
- Alta velocità di backup
- Possibilità di programmare i backup in base alle necessità
- Possiamo escludere file o cartelle dal backup
- È possibile inviare la copia in rete tramite SSH
- Con FWbackups avremo organizzazione e pulizia nelle esecuzioni
FWBackup
NotaNel caso di installazione in Ubuntu 16, questi sono i comandi che dobbiamo seguire per la rispettiva installazione:
sudo apt-get install gettext autotools-dev intltool python-crypto python-paramiko python-gtk2 python-glade2 python-notify cron tar xfj fwbackups-1.43.6.tar.bz2 cd fwbackups-1.43.6 ./configure --prefix = / usr make && sudo make install
Clonezilla
Uno degli strumenti più utilizzati per i temi di backup è senza dubbio Clonezilla. Con Clonezilla abbiamo la possibilità di clonare un disco completo o di crearne delle immagini. Clonezilla è un'utilità del disco che deve essere eseguita all'avvio del sistema. Le sue caratteristiche principali sono:
- Supporta un gran numero di file di sistema come ext2, ext3, ext4, reiserfs, reiser4, FAT32, HFS +, OpenBSD, tra molti altri.
- Includi GRUB nel tuo bootloader
- Con una sola immagine possiamo ripristinare vari dispositivi
- Le immagini create con Clonezilla possono essere localizzate su dischi rigidi locali, connessioni di rete SSH, server NFS, tra gli altri.
- Ha la crittografia AES a 256 bit che aumenta la sicurezza dei file
- Clonezilla supporta il multicast
- Può essere avviato con formati di partizione MBR o GPT
Clonezilla
Abbiamo a disposizione diversi strumenti gratuiti che renderanno i backup un'esperienza semplice e di grande supporto, in quanto questa deve diventare un'abitudine per avere sempre informazioni affidabili, aggiornate e soprattutto protette da attacchi interni o esterni che potrebbero interessarle. Otteniamo il massimo da questi strumenti.